Biography

B. J. Dubose, born on January 19, 1992, in the United States, is a former professional American football player who played as a defensive end in the National Football League (NFL). After displaying exceptional talent at the collegiate level, he was selected in the sixth round of the 2015 NFL Draft by the Minnesota Vikings.
